Launching Intercultural Lullabies in Bunbury

Intercultural Lullabies is a celebration of language and culture through song. It is the coming together of Noongar and intercultural communities to share lullabies, language and culture, and to create lullabies in multiple languages.

The project launched with a workshop at the Djidi Djidi Aboriginal School. We were thrilled to have Noongar elders (Melba Wallam, Phyllis Bennell & Gloria Dann), City of Bunbury Councillor Gabi Ghasseb, his wife Rita and school principal Karen Augustson attend the workshop. The group sang lullabies together and learned to pronounce words in different languages. Some little ones fell asleep to the soothing sounds of the lullabies during the workshop.

The second workshop of this project was held at Yallo Dalyellup. During this workshop the group learned about the similarities and differences of the dialectical groups within a country ( 3 within Philippines, 2 within Noongar country and 2 Chinese heritage).

It was a delight to have some men join the workshops.
